Output 943b6f6686eb2de27d38b563228938b0ac0ebf5442ce883ea8697835cd626e3b:9

value
66513610
script pubkey
OP_0 OP_PUSHBYTES_20 e17e23b09d575debe2a263f58090a05ab7abefb7
address
ltc1qu9lz8vya2aw7hc4zv06cpy9qt2m6hmahl8t5z6
transaction
943b6f6686eb2de27d38b563228938b0ac0ebf5442ce883ea8697835cd626e3b
spent
true